Los Angeles Wildfires Grow More Massive, Losses Reach Rp 2,447 Trillion

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The Los Angeles wildfire; Los Angeles is one of the largest cities in the United States, and is now currently facing the worst disaster in its history.

The wildfire, which has been raging since January 7, 2025, has claimed lives, destroyed thousands of homes, and forced more than 100,000 people to evacuate. This tragedy is a major blow not only to Californians, but also to the United States, which has had to deal with enormous economic and social impacts.

Casualties and Material Losses

As of Sunday, January 12, 2025, the death toll from this fire has increased to 24 people, according to a report from the Los Angeles Department of Medical Examiners. Another 12 people were reported missing, increasing the likelihood that the death toll will continue to rise. Among them, eight victims died from the Palisades Fire on the west side of the city, while 16 others were found in the Eaton Fire in the foothills east of Los Angeles.

In addition to the loss of life, this fire also caused massive damage to infrastructure and property. More than 12,000 buildings have been damaged or destroyed, while economic losses are estimated at $135 billion to $150 billion (around Rp2,200 trillion–Rp2,447 trillion). According to Moody's Ratings, this fire could be one of the most costly fires in U.S. history.

Firefighting and Evacuation Efforts

Firefighters continue to work hard to extinguish the fires in several critical areas. However, strong Santa Ana winds gusting up to 112 kilometers per hour have complicated their efforts. So far, the Palisades Fire is only 11 percent contained, while the Eaton Fire is 27 percent contained. Several other fires in the Los Angeles area have reportedly been fully contained.

Local authorities have also ordered the evacuation of more than 100,000 Los Angeles County residents. Areas such as Pasadena, Altadena, and Sylmar have become major evacuation sites, with thousands now living in temporary evacuation centers.

Amid this chaos, the Indonesian community in Los Angeles has also been affected. Based on the report of the Indonesian Ministry of Foreign Affairs, there were 97 Indonesian citizens affected, including four people who received direct assistance from the Indonesian Consulate General in Los Angeles.

In addition, several Indonesian diaspora were reported to have lost their homes due to the fire. The Indonesian Consulate General in Los Angeles continues to monitor the situation and provide assistance to the victims.

United States Government Response

President Joe Biden has designated the fire as a major disaster, allowing the federal government to provide direct assistance to victims.

The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) has mobilized resources to assist victims, including funds for home repairs, replacement of lost food, and medicine. "We will continue to support this response and recovery," said Deanne Criswell, FEMA Administrator.

California Governor Gavin Newsom also issued an executive order to speed up the process of rebuilding destroyed homes and businesses by temporarily suspending several environmental regulations.

Newsom called the Los Angeles wildfire one of the worst natural disasters in US history, highlighting the enormous economic and social impacts.
